The Ingoldby name has been an essential part of McLaren Vale viticulture for over a century. Choice parcels of Shiraz are sourced from premium McLaren Vale sites, including the Ingoldby family property at McLaren Flat. Fruit is earmarked on the basis of intense flavour and fine tannins. Parcels are vinified separately in a mix of fermenters and pressed off skins upon completion. Some components are matured in seasoned oak barrels to derive complexity, the balance remain unoaked to return vital fruit characters and preserve freshness. Prior to assemblage, each component is assessed to strike the perfect balance of lifted fruit and gentle tannins, supple oak and fine complexity.

Deep purple/ red colour. An enticing nose redolent of dark summer berry compote with hints of chocolate. Subtle oak lets the fruit do the talking and plays a supportive, integrated role. The palate is rich and round with purple fruits, dense but supple tannins contributing power with finesse, balance and good length.
